About acetic acid;alumane;cobalt;nickel
acetic acid;alumane;cobalt;nickel (PubChem CID 175191172) has the molecular formula C2H7AlCoNiO2
and a molecular weight of 207.68 g/mol. Its IUPAC name is acetic acid;alumane;cobalt;nickel.
